The name Calvin originates from the French surname 'Cauvin', which itself is derived from the Latin word 'calvus', meaning 'bald'. It gained popularity as a given name in honor of John Calvin, the influential Protestant reformer. The name has a vintage charm and has been used consistently over the centuries.
